    Does Cork Rendering Help with Damp and Insulation?

    Introduction

    Damp and poor insulation are common issues in many UK homes, particularly in older properties across South West London.

    How cork helps with damp

    Cork is a breathable material that allows moisture trapped within walls to escape while preventing external water from penetrating. This helps reduce the likelihood of damp-related issues over time.

    How it improves insulation

    The natural structure of cork contains air pockets that help retain heat, improving thermal performance and contributing to more stable indoor temperatures.

    Typical outcomes

    Homeowners may experience a warmer property during colder months, reduced condensation and improved overall comfort.

    Important consideration

    While cork rendering can help manage moisture, any significant structural damp issues should be assessed before installation.
